THE ROLE

The Swim Instructor/Lifeguard plays an important role, providing quality leisure programs, services and ensuring the safety of our military members and their families.

Our services are tailored to help families with the challenges they may face due to military life and make the most of everyday activities such as going to the pool or beach. We believe that when members of the Canadian Armed Forces are able to take good care of themselves and their families, they can do better both at home and at work. Whether families need to sign the kids up for swimming lessons, improve their fitness, make friends in a new community, our services are here to help.

Lifeguarding is an exciting and rewarding job that carries great responsibility. Guards take courses and train hard for events they hope will never happen and which they work hard to prevent. As a Swim Instructor/Lifeguard, you will prepare and deliver swimming lessons and supervise those using the pool ensuring their safety. When guarding you will prevent accidents and spot potential trouble and intervene before it becomes life‑threatening. You will explain safety rules to swimmers and enforce them. As an instructor you will teach participants how to swim and be responsible for designing activities for particular groups, such as seniors or children. You will motivate your students and help them reach their full potential. QUALIFICATIONS NEEDED
Education, Certifications and Licenses
  • An acceptable combination of education, training and/or experience
  • Current CPR and Standard First Aid certification
  • Current National Lifeguard Service (NLS) certification
  • Current recognized Swim Instructor certification
  • HIGH FIVE Principles of Healthy Child Development or HIGH FIVE Sport (successful completion by end of probation)
  • HIGH FIVE Healthy Minds for Healthy Children (successful completion by end of probation)
Experience
  • In dealing with the public, including, but not limited to, children
  • In performing lifeguard duties
  • In the implementation of training and practice sessions
  • In the development and implementation of individual training plans
  • In cash handling, as required
Competencies
  • Client focus, organizational knowledge, communication, innovation, teamwork and leadership
Skills and Abilities
  • Observational skills
  • Communication skills
  • Ability to work independently and as part of a team
  • Ability to react and respond in emergency situations
LANGUAGE REQUIREMENTS

English Essential / Bilingual (English and French) an asset

Reading: None

Writing: None

Oral: Functional
